Output 6e405143f6beee31ebe16d159f443292e3379c3cc540afe4da9074abf918caa7:94

value
578422
script pubkey
OP_0 OP_PUSHBYTES_20 bd39f351a8a0455c2a775f6055113106a2794d2a
address
bc1qh5ulx5dg5pz4c2nhtas92yf3q638jnf2mpqdns
transaction
6e405143f6beee31ebe16d159f443292e3379c3cc540afe4da9074abf918caa7
spent
true